You'll find your location ID in the settings under business mode, which you can easily copy and share. For the API token, go to private integrations, create a new integration, and choose the appropriate scopes to limit access—like view and edit contacts and tags. Remember to copy the API key after creation, as you won't be able to see it again. Please handle these tokens carefully, as they grant significant access to your sub-account."}
